Iberdrola’s Avangrid to Acquire PNM Resources

Posted on 10/21/2020


Spanish renewable energy firm Iberdrola inked a deal to acquire utility PNM Resources through its U.S. unit Avangrid, Inc. The enterprise value of the deal is US$ 8.3 billion. The board of PNM Resources approved the US$ 4.3 billion offer to its shareholders.

Iberdrola is searching for regulated businesses and renewable energy in markets that have legal and regulatory stability. This is Iberdrola’s eighth deal for 2020 as part of a 10 billion euro investment plan.

PNM Resources is an energy holding company based in Albuquerque, New Mexico, with 2019 consolidated operating revenues of US$ 1.5 billion.
